2014-03-12 2 views
2

안녕 얘들 아,log4j와 함께 이동 경로 로깅?

log4j 로그에 flyway 출력을 얻는 가장 좋은 방법은 무엇입니까?

나는 현재 다음의 log4j.xml로 실행 해요 :

<?xml version="1.0" encoding="UTF-8"?> 
<!DOCTYPE log4j:configuration SYSTEM "log4j.dtd"> 

<log4j:configuration> 
    <appender name="CA" class="org.apache.log4j.ConsoleAppender"> 
     <layout class="org.apache.log4j.PatternLayout"> 
      <param name="ConversionPattern" value="%-p - %m%n"/> 
     </layout> 
     <filter class="org.apache.log4j.varia.LevelRangeFilter"> 
      <param name="levelMin" value="INFO"/> 
      <param name="levelMax" value="ERROR"/> 
     </filter> 
    </appender> 

    <appender name="fileAppender" class="org.apache.log4j.RollingFileAppender"> 
     <param name="append" value="false"/> 
     <param name="file" value="log.out"/> 
     <param name="immediateFlush" value="true"/> 
     <layout class="org.apache.log4j.PatternLayout"> 
      <param name="ConversionPattern" value="%d{ABSOLUTE} %-5p [%c{1}] %m%n"/> 
     </layout> 
    </appender> 

    <logger name="com.googlecode.flyway.core.migration" additivity="false"> 
     <level value="DEBUG"/> 
     <appender-ref ref="fileAppender"/> 
    </logger> 

    <root> 
     <priority value="all"/> 
     <appender-ref ref="CA"/> 
     <appender-ref ref="fileAppender"/> 
    </root> 
</log4j:configuration> 

은 이미 온라인 답변을 검색 한하지만 그것을 알아낼 수 없었다.

답변

2

Flyway는 클래스 경로에서 사용할 수있는 Log4J를 자동으로 사용합니다.